From 0a4a8b7a01681c20fd632164a99b2ad627ac08d7 Mon Sep 17 00:00:00 2001 From: Paul Gofman Date: Fri, 26 Feb 2021 14:44:29 +0300 Subject: [PATCH] wineopexr: Don't consider XrCompositionLayerColorScaleBiasKHR in convert_XrCompositionLayer(). This structure is not inherited from XrCompositionLayerBaseHeader but is supposed to be passed as chained structure with a layer. --- wineopenxr/openxr.c | 5 ----- 1 file changed, 5 deletions(-) diff --git a/wineopenxr/openxr.c b/wineopenxr/openxr.c index 09d65a01..e1811df7 100644 --- a/wineopenxr/openxr.c +++ b/wineopenxr/openxr.c @@ -42,7 +42,6 @@ union CompositionLayer { XrCompositionLayerDepthInfoKHR depth_info; XrCompositionLayerCylinderKHR cylinder; XrCompositionLayerEquirectKHR equirect; - XrCompositionLayerColorScaleBiasKHR color_scale_bias; XrCompositionLayerEquirect2KHR equirect2; }; @@ -1489,10 +1488,6 @@ static XrCompositionLayerBaseHeader *convert_XrCompositionLayer(wine_XrSession * out_layer->quad.subImage.swapchain = ((wine_XrSwapchain *)out_layer->quad.subImage.swapchain)->swapchain; break; - case XR_TYPE_COMPOSITION_LAYER_COLOR_SCALE_BIAS_KHR: - /* no conversion needed */ - return (XrCompositionLayerBaseHeader *)in_layer; - default: WINE_WARN("Unknown composition in_layer type: %d\n", in_layer->type); return (XrCompositionLayerBaseHeader *)in_layer;